Method for dyeing superfine fibre synthetic leather by utilizing tannin extract
A technology of superfine fiber and synthetic leather, applied in dyeing, textile and papermaking, etc., can solve the problems of restricting product development, producing a single variety of products, and being difficult to meet market requirements, and achieving the effect of improving dyeing fastness.

Examples
Embodiment 1
[0019] 1) Put superfine fiber synthetic leather into the drum and add 80°C hot water of 1200% of its mass and 8% wattle extract to rotate for 100 minutes;
[0020] 2) Add industrial formic acid to the drum to adjust the pH value of the dyeing bath to 4.5, and rotate for 100 minutes;
[0021] 3) Add 3% FeSO of superfine fiber synthetic leather quality in the rotating drum 4 , rotate for 100 minutes;
[0022] 4) Add the cross-linking agent glutaraldehyde of 2% of superfine fiber synthetic leather quality in the drum and rotate for 100 minutes to discharge the liquid;
[0023] 5) Add 80°C hot water with 1200% superfine fiber synthetic leather quality to the drum after draining, and drain the liquid again after rotating for 5 minutes;
[0024] 6) Add 80°C hot water with 1200% superfine fiber synthetic leather quality to the drained drum, rotate for 5 minutes and drain the liquid again to obtain dyed superfine fiber synthetic leather.
Embodiment 2
[0026] 1) put the microfiber synthetic leather into the drum and add 800% of its quality hot water at 65°C and 10% bayberry extract to rotate for 80 minutes;
[0027] 2) Add industrial formic acid to the drum to adjust the pH value of the dyeing bath to 4.8, and rotate for 80 minutes;
[0028] 3) Add 2% FeSO of superfine fiber synthetic leather quality in the rotating drum 4 , rotate for 80 minutes;
[0029] 4) Add 1% cross-linking agent modified glutaraldehyde of superfine fiber synthetic leather quality to the rotating drum and discharge the liquid after rotating for 80 minutes;
[0030] 5) Add 65°C hot water with 800% superfine fiber synthetic leather quality to the drained drum, and drain the liquid again after rotating for 8 minutes;
[0031] 6) Add hot water at 65°C with 800% superfine fiber synthetic leather quality to the drum after draining, rotate for 8 minutes and drain the liquid again to obtain superfine fiber synthetic leather after dyeing.
Embodiment 3
[0033] 1) Superfine fiber synthetic leather is packed into the rotating drum and add 95 ℃ hot water of 600% of its quality and 4% larch extract to rotate for 60 minutes;
[0034] 2) Add industrial formic acid to the drum to adjust the pH value of the dyeing bath to 5.0, and rotate for 60 minutes;
[0035]3) Add the CoCl of superfine fiber synthetic leather quality 1% in the rotating drum 2 , rotate for 60 minutes;
[0036] 4) Add the cross-linking agent oxazolidine tanning agent of 3% of superfine fiber synthetic leather quality to the rotating drum and discharge the liquid after rotating for 60 minutes;
[0037] 5) Add 95°C hot water with 600% superfine fiber synthetic leather quality to the drained drum, and drain the liquid again after rotating for 10 minutes;
[0038] 6) Add 95° C. hot water of 600% of the superfine fiber synthetic leather quality to the drained drum, rotate for 10 minutes and drain the liquid again to obtain the dyed superfine fiber synthetic leather. ...
